Project Description:
Applicant proposes the construction of a 82' above ground level monopole communications tower and associated equipment to be contained within an existing self-storage facility. The proposal is located greater than 750 feet from the Peconic River. The property is situated in the Recreational corridor of the Peconic River. The Peconic River is designated as a Wild, Scenic and Recreational River. The facility is located on River Road, Calverton, Town of Riverhead, Suffolk County. SCTM# 600-118-1-6.2.

Project Description:
The applicant proposes to install an irrigation well to a depth of 80 feet and having a pump capacity of 225 gallons per minute to irrigate containerized ornamentals. The project is located 1,265 feet north of Route 25 and 155 feet east of Sterling Lane, Cutchogue, Southold Town, SCTM #1000-96-3-9.
